As with every other type of equipment, the
first question is that of a logistical
nature - Is this keyboard for enjoyment in
your home? To teach your children? Perhaps
this will be the focal point of a recording
studio or rehearsal space.
Presently, there is a huge variety of
musical keyboards. The good news is that the
top Manufacturers these days only create a
quality product - it really is hard to go
wrong. The only downside these days is
choosing a model that is either below or
beyond you specific needs.
If you can afford it, always go for a higher
end model. If you choose a cheaper keyboard,
9 times out of 10 you'll wish you'd spent
the extra money. However, if you really
can't afford it, take comfort in knowing
that you're still getting a quality product
- it's simply a matter of features that
you'll be lacking.
Remember, it's always better to buy a low
cost model from a respected brand name than
it is to buy the top end model from a
'no-name' dealer.
High-end manufacturers all make musical
keyboards for professional use. They've been
doing it for years, and know how to do it
right. The really neat thing is that they
put a great deal of their high-end
technology into their low cost instruments.
Why not take advantage of this?
Be sure to shop around, and remember, cheap
does not always equate to a good deal. Stick
with the big brands and you'll do fine. |
